About 27 St James Gardens

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

27 St James Gardens is a five-bedroom detached house in Mansfield Woodhouse, Mansfield, Mansfield (NG19 9FE). It has a recorded floor area of 157 m² (around 1690 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007 onwards and council tax band D. There is a swimming pool on the plot, uncommon for the area. The latest certificate (September 2014) returns a B (score 81), comfortably above the UK average. The latest certificate is from September 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

At 157 m² the property is well over the postcode median (71 m² across 19 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 79% of similar EPCs). 5 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 4 is the typical count.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2009.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2008–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£234/sq ft) was about 28.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: February 2023 at £395,000.
